Hexarelin Protects Rodent Pancreatic Β-Cells Function from Cytotoxic Effects of Streptozotocin Involving Mitochondrial Signalling Pathways In Vivo and In Vitro

Fig 2

Hex reduced STZ-induced mitochondrial damage and in pancreatic cells.

The MIN6 and α-TC6 cells were treated with 1.0 mM STZ and 1.0 μM Hex alone or in combination. Cell viability of (A) the MIN6 and (B) α-TC6 cells was measured by MTS assay (n = 6). The MIN6 cells were then treated with 1.0 mM STZ and 1.0 μM Hex alone or in combination. (C) The changes in the mitochondrial potential of the MIN6 were determined by Rhodamine 123 assay. (D) Cell superoxide activity of the MIN6 was detected by superoxide DHE production. The data are presented as the mean ± SEM (n = 8). *p < 0.05, compared with the control group; #p < 0.05, ##p < 0.01, compared with the STZ group.
